There are 14 planes of existence - 7 upper planes and 7 lower planes.
Below are the upper planes (called lokas in Sanskrit):
  1. Satya
  2. Tapas
  3. Jana
  4. Maha
  5. Swarga (Lower heaven)
  6. Bhuva (Astral plane)
  7. Bhur (Earth)
These are planes or states of consciousness, so they have no location in space. They superimpose each other in space- you can travel from one to the other without actually moving physically in space.

The beings that inhabit that Bhuva or Astral plane can actually pass through and see us on the Earth plane (Bhur) all the time. Astral plane is what Christians call purgatory.

“The spiritual world is like unto the phenomenal world. They are the exact counterpart of each other. Whatever objects appear in this world of existence are the outer pictures of the world of heaven.” The Promulgation of Universal Peace, p. 10

“Your questions, however, can be answered only briefly, since there is no time for a detailed reply. The answer to the first question: the souls of the children of the Kingdom, after their separation from the body, ascend unto the realm of everlasting life. But if ye ask as to the place, know ye that the world of existence is a single world, although its stations are various and distinct.” Selections From the Writings of ‘Abdu’l-Bahá, p. 193

“Those who have passed on through death, have a sphere of their own. It is not removed from ours; their work, the work of the Kingdom, is ours; but it is sanctified from what we call ‘time and place.’ Time with us is measured by the sun. When there is no more sunrise, and no more sunset, that kind of time does not exist for man. Those who have ascended have different attributes from those who are still on earth, yet there is no real separation.” ‘Abdu’l-Bahá in London, pp. 95-96
